About HELLO HACKER

Every hacker starts somewhere. Usually, it's a blinking cursor and a bad idea.

H3LL0 H4CK3R throws you in with nothing but a terminal and your wits (and a hint system for those that need it). No hand-holding. No tutorials written by people who've never seen a command line. Just you, the machine, and a network that's begging to be compromised.Crack systems. Cover your tracks. Build your legend—or get traced and burned.This isn't a game about hacking. This is hacking.

What To Expect

WARNING! - HELLO HACKER will challenge you to be curious and to read and pay attention to everything. You never know what will be a clue that you need later. You will experience a realistic Linux terminal, with real commands. Careful, you may learn something. If you are interested in Linux, cybersecurity or CTF's like TryHackMe, then this game is for you. Use hints when you get stuck, but be careful... they may cost you with your place on the global leaderboard.

The Mission

Alex Chen, a security researcher and your friend, is missing. Before going missing, Alex left you an encrypted system with one final message: "Find the breadcrumbs. Expose the truth." Now it's your turn to finish what Alex started - but be warned: once you discover the truth, you become the next target.

Authentic Hacking Gameplay

Use real Unix commands and cybersecurity techniques to: - Scan networks with nmap to discover hidden servers - Crack passwords using wordlists and pattern analysis - Decrypt files with cryptographic tools (base64, hex, XOR ciphers) - Query databases to extract sensitive information - Use SSH to gain unauthorized access - Chain discoveries - each server contains clues to infiltrate the next

Key Features

✓ 10 interconnected servers across corporate and government networks✓ Realistic command-line interface with 10+ Unix commands✓ Multiple password discovery methods - dictionary attacks, decryption, database queries✓ Network reconnaissance with CIDR scanning and port scanning ✓ Progressive story told through emails, logs, and documents✓ Cryptography puzzles requiring decoding and cipher-breaking✓ No combat, pure problem-solving - use your brain, not bullets

Recommended Jan 3, 2026
Short and good game, is similar to CTF's from pentesting training sites. A bit annoying with the intrusion detection system, as the mechanic was not very well explained and disconnects you back to your local machine. There were only 2 puzzles that actually stopped me, one was me using "ls" and not "ls -a" meaning I missed some hidden files. The other one was at the start where a password was said to be what makes the company unique. The password was the name of the company, it's not very intuitive
